AI Summary
- Amends Joint Rule 21 to require proceedings of each house be recorded and live streamed by an authorized designee
- Permits either house to suspend or end recording and/or live streaming upon a two-thirds vote of the chamber
- Specifies that statements made during floor or committee proceedings reflect only the individual speaker and do not represent legislative intent by the body as a whole
- Requires the Director of Legislative Services to maintain all recordings for two years, then transfer copies of recordings older than two years to the state archivist
- Prohibits any member of the Legislature, its employees, or designees from certifying or authenticating any recording made under this rule
Legislative Description
Stating findings of the Legislature and providing for the amendment of Joint Rule 21 regarding provisions relating to certain recorded proceedings.
